#7d1d4d basic color information

#7d1d4d

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#7d1d4d has decimal index of: 8199501, is composed of 49% red, 11.4% green and 30.2% blue. #7d1d4d in CMYK color model, is composed of 0% cyan, 76.8% magenta, 38.4% yellow and 51% black.
#663366 is the closest web-safe color to #7d1d4d.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.

Monochromatic

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
